Of course, detailed information about Jinci Temple is as follows: Jinci Temple, located at the foot of Xuanweng Mountain, about 25 kilometers southwest of Taiyuan City, Shanxi Province, China, at the source of the Jin River, is a temple built to commemorate Tang Shuyu (later posthumously honored as King of Jin), the founding ruler of the Jin State. It is the oldest existing royal sacrificial garden in China. It integrates ancient Chinese sacrificial architecture, gardens, sculptures, murals, and stele inscriptions, and is world-renowned for its precious historical value and unique artistic charm, earning it the titles of "Little Jiangnan of Shanxi" and "Museum of Ancient Chinese Architecture."

Jinci Temple is undoubtedly a must-visit treasure trove of historical sites in Shanxi Province. A testament to a thousand years of Chinese civilization and a gem of Chinese architecture, no matter how many times you visit Taiyuan, you must take the time to explore it thoroughly. The Temple of the Holy Mother boasts the elegance of the Northern Song Dynasty, the only ancient stele of Emperor Taizong of Tang, the unique Fish Pond Flying Bridge, and the three-thousand-year-old Zhou Cypress—the list goes on and on, offering countless sights that you'll never tire of.

The balcony seating for "Dreaming Back to the Tang Dynasty" offers good value for money. Higher vantage points provide a clear view of the entire stage and all the lighting effects. The downside is that the distance makes it difficult to see the actors' facial details. A front-row, center seat on the second floor is recommended for minimal obstruction. The performance uses song and dance combined with lighting and water mist effects to showcase the grandeur of the Tang Dynasty. The costumes, props, and sets are exquisite and luxurious. The plot is simple with minimal dialogue, focusing primarily on visual enjoyment. Enter the park through the South Gate first, as it's closer to the theater. After the performance, you can also check out the park's nighttime views.

I was initially hesitant about whether the VIP area was worth it, but after watching it, I was truly amazed! It truly lives up to its Guinness World Record for the largest theater stage. Entering the performance hall felt less like stepping into a theater and more like entering an archaeological site. The rammed earth, terracotta warriors, armor, and chariots instantly transported the audience back two thousand years. The high-tech lighting, combined with a 20-meter-high water screen projection, created a seamless integration of sound, light, and electricity.
